Village Overview

Bhorthain is a village in Kathua Tehsil, also recorded as a Census sub-district, Kathua district, Jammu & Kashmir. For Bhorthain, the population is 2,508, PIN code is 184143 and Census village code is 1791. Location and Administration

Bhorthain comes under Bhorthain South gram panchayat and Barnoti C.D. Block. Its local administrative unit is Kathua Tehsil, also recorded as a Census sub-district. The tehsil headquarters is Kathua at 30 km. The Census district headquarters, Kathua, is 30 km away.

Agriculture and Land Use

Land-use area is reported in hectares using Census village directory land-use categories such as net area sown, irrigated area, forest, fallow land and non-agricultural use. This is useful for general village research, farming context and local area study.

Agriculture and land-use records for Bhorthain
Net area sown369 hectares
Irrigated area54 hectares
Unirrigated area315 hectares
Canal irrigated area54 hectares
Forest area683 hectares
Non-agricultural area1,360 hectares
Main cropPaddy
Second cropWheat
Third cropMaize
